Understanding the 13B Engine
The 13B engine is a part of Mazda’s Wankel rotary family and is known for its unique design and performance characteristics. Unlike traditional piston engines, the rotary engine operates on a different principle, utilizing a triangular rotor that spins within an oval-shaped housing. This design results in a compact engine that can deliver impressive power outputs relative to its size.
Key Features of a Reliable 13B Build
When building a reliable daily driver 13B engine, several key features must be considered to ensure performance, durability, and affordability. Here are the essential components:
- Rotors: Choose high-quality rotors that can withstand the stress of daily driving.
- Seals: Opt for upgraded apex and side seals to enhance longevity and reduce oil consumption.
- Intake and Exhaust: A proper intake and exhaust system can improve airflow and performance.
- Fuel System: Ensure the fuel system is capable of delivering the necessary fuel for your power goals.
- Cooling System: An efficient cooling system is crucial to prevent overheating during daily use.

Power vs. Efficiency: Finding the Right Balance
One of the most critical aspects of building a reliable 13B engine is striking the right balance between power and efficiency. Here are some considerations:
- Turbocharging: A turbocharger can significantly increase power but may compromise reliability if not properly tuned.
- NA Builds: Naturally aspirated builds are generally simpler and can provide a reliable power band without the complexity of forced induction.
- Tuning: A professional tune can optimize the engine’s performance while ensuring it remains reliable for daily use.
